They hug because they fulfill all the tasks that unelected bureaucrats give them, - the Chairman of the Georgian Parliament, Shalva Papuashvili, told journalists.
According to Papuashvili, when European bureaucrats talk about Georgia “falling behind” Moldova and Ukraine in specific criteria, “they do not care at all that they are throwing such lies directly in the eyes of the Georgian people.”
“In general, we see anti-Georgian rhetoric from the EU and Brussels institutions, which is very sad. We often hear attacks on the Georgian people, on their right to choose their own government. We saw direct intervention by Brussels in order to change the government in Georgia from the outside. Both before the parliamentary elections, when the EU ambassador was involved in the election campaign in violation of international law, and in supporting the October 4 coup, when it was known in advance that Nepal was to be organized in Georgia. The European Commission’s spokesperson supported the organization of this Nepal. To this day, no EU member has apologized to the Georgian people for the support that the European Commission, in principle, expressed to the organizers of the Nepal scenario, through the European Commission’s spokesperson.
As for Ukraine and Moldova. I will not say anything about the injustice in this context, in comparison. This is simply a mockery of the Georgian people. This is a mockery of the Georgian people when they talk as if Ukraine and Moldova are ahead of Georgia in some objective way. Of course, they are ahead in hugging the Brussels bureaucracy. We are not better. They hug because they fulfill all the tasks that unelected bureaucrats give. We are not better in this. However, we are better in all other parameters. We are better in economic development, democratic institutions.
As for the media, there is total control in Ukraine. There is a similar situation in Moldova. Those media outlets that are critical of the government have problems. Not to mention corruption.
Every European bureaucrat who says that Georgia is behind Ukraine and Moldova in some way is simply mocking the Georgian people in that they say unfair things. They are not worried that such a lie is being thrown directly into the eyes of the Georgian people, which is a mockery of the Georgian people," Papuashvili said.
